Spirituality of the Body


Spirituality of the Body

A 5Rhythms Movement Meditation

This workshop brings together two distinct — and at times contrasting — understandings of 5Rhythms as a spiritual practice.

Rather than presenting a unified method, the work holds a living paradox at the heart of human experience: we experience ourselves as separate, bounded individuals, and yet we belong to something fundamentally unified. Both perspectives are explored through direct bodily experience.

The body is not bypassed or reduced to biology. It is the place where life is met directly. When the body is listened to and allowed to move, it does not demand constant attention. It becomes trustworthy ground. From that place, attention can widen. Instead of monitoring oneself, there is participation. Instead of tightening around identity, there is contact. The question is no longer - Who do I believe myself to be?, but - What is moving through me?

At times the work will be precise, sensory, and grounded in somatic awareness. At other times it will open into spacious, archetypal, and devotional movement. The tension between these modes is not something to resolve, but something to stay with — and to dance.

Indigenous traditions speak of humans as “double beings.” One aspect of us lives in separation, threat, and competition. Another knows itself as part of a larger unity, held in harmony and shared belonging. This workshop does not ask participants to choose between these views, but to experience how both arise — and dissolve — through movement.

The central inquiry is simple and uncompromising:

Is the body the place where identity takes shape?

Or the place where the sense of separation relaxes, revealing what has always been one?

This is a practice space — rigorous, embodied, and experiential — for those willing to remain present in paradox, difference, and not-knowing. Not as a search for answers, but as an exploration of what becomes visible when movement is allowed to move us.

An invitation to inhabit the body, to let movement unfold, and to allow spirituality to emerge.

About Erik Iversen

Erik Iversen is a founding member of the 5Rhythms worldwide community. He was in his first training with Gabrielle in 1988 and become one of her first workshop producers out of Montreal in the 80’s. Over the following 40 years, he has taught the 5Rhythms in 15 countries as well as maintaining a one-on-one bodywork practice; over time he has integrated the wisdom he gained from his hands-on work with the insights from guiding thousands of dancers on the dance floor.

In 2016, he graduated from the 2-year Leadership and Transformation training at the Hendricks Institute. In 2020 he designed the Somatomy,™ a 3-module training that guides participants playfully through an experiential understanding of their anatomy. This approach offers powerful tools for creating deep presence and flow through 5Rhythms movement and conscious embodiment.
